I am growing seedlings of the Sorbus domestica in the arboretum in Seattle. No fruit yet from the seedlings, about 4 feet tall. The mother tree had fruit with a nice pear essence plus hints of rose. Definitely not for eating fresh. Too much tannin. Would be a good component in cider or fruit wine.
